How much do local international biomedical engineer jobs pay per year?

As of Jun 9, 2026, the average yearly pay for local international biomedical engineer in the United States is $94,807.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$74,500.00 and $116,000.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

Job Description
THIS ROLE IS CONTINGENT ON AN ANTICIPATED CONTRACT AWARD. SUBMITTING AN APPLICATION ALLOWS YOU TO BE CONSIDERED FOR THE POSITION UPON AWARD.
The Biomedical Engineer / Clinical Engineer will provide subject matter expertise in patient safety and medical device management to support the VA's Healthcare Technology Management (HTM) Program Office. This role is critical to ensuring compliance with patient safety goals, regulatory requirements, and industry standards across the Veterans Health Administration (VHA).
Key Responsibilities
  • Manage recall and safety alert programs for medical devices, including hazard investigations, ensuring compliance with Safe Medical Devices Act (SMDA) and The Joint Commission (TJC) requirements.
  • Conduct medical equipment management programs compliant with healthcare standards and regulatory agencies.
  • Support incident investigations involving medical equipment and develop preventive strategies to mitigate risks.
  • Collaborate with HTM Program Office and field-based stakeholders to implement best practices for patient safety and medical device reliability.
  • Provide expertise in networking protocols, information security, and computer-based medical systems as they relate to medical technology.
  • Assist in developing and maintaining Medical Equipment Management Plans (MEMPs) and related policies.
  • Ensure adherence to VA, federal, and international standards, including ISO requirements.

Required Qualifications
  • Education: Bachelor's degree or higher in Engineering OR Certification as a Clinical Engineer (CCE).
  • Experience:
    • 5+ years of experience managing medical device recall and safety alert programs.
    • Demonstrated competency in medical device hazard investigations and compliance with patient safety goals.
    • Proven ability to communicate and collaborate effectively with technical and professional staff at all levels of a healthcare organization.
  • Technical Knowledge:
    • Computer-based medical systems, networking protocols, and information security principles.
    • Regulatory requirements and ISO standards applicable to medical technology.
Additional Information
  • Travel: Up to 30 trips per year may be required (4-5 days per trip).
  • Security Clearance: Background investigation and VA Contractor PIV badge required prior to commencement of work.
  • Contract Type: Firm fixed-price deliverables-based contract.
  • Performance Period: Base period of 12 months with four 12-month option periods.
